Van der Sar body blow for United
Date published: 05 August 2009
MANCHESTER United goalkeeper Edwin van der Sar is expected to be sidelined for eight weeks after undergoing surgery on a broken finger and bone in his left hand.
The 38–year–old Dutchman sustained the injury saving a penalty from Danijel Pranjic in the Red Devils’ 7–6 shoot–out defeat to Bayern Munich in the pre–season Audi Cup in Germany.
Van der Sar is not expected to be back in Sir Alex Ferguson’s plans until late September, meaning the Scot will have to turn to either Ben Foster or Tomasz Kuszczak for the start of the new season.
Meanwhile, Ferguson says Chelsea will pose the biggest threat to United’s dream of a fourth consecutive Premier League title.
